Choosing the Right Materials for the Massachusetts Climate
The foundation of a long-lasting deck is choosing materials that can handle everything our climate throws at them—from heavy snow and ice in the winter to hot, humid summers. The right choice depends on your budget, desired aesthetic, and how much maintenance you're willing to do.
-
Pressure-Treated Lumber: This is the most common and budget-friendly option. It's chemically treated to resist rot, fungus, and insects. While it's a reliable choice, it requires regular maintenance, including annual cleaning and staining or sealing every few years, to prevent splitting and warping.
-
Cedar and Redwood: These softwoods are naturally beautiful and contain oils that make them resistant to rot and insects. They offer a classic, high-end look but come at a higher price point. Like pressure-treated wood, they require regular maintenance to preserve their color and integrity.
-
Composite Decking: For homeowners seeking a low-maintenance solution, composite materials are an excellent choice. Made from a blend of wood fibers and recycled plastics, composite decking is highly durable, resistant to fading, staining, and mold, and never needs sanding or staining. While the upfront cost is higher, the long-term value and minimal upkeep make it a popular investment for busy families.
